Return of image-surface backed canvas (windows graphics performance)
This partially reverts 2edbda2526.
Using cairo-groups increases performance on MacOS, and retains
retina-resolution.
However it adds a performance regression for MS Windows graphics
rendering. cairo-groups use a "similar" surface, not an image surface.
Empirically this adds significant overhead compared to rendering
using the CPU and using bitblt.
